I came across the "Ark of Taste" page on Slow Food USA - these flavorful foods are endangered and recommended for saving - all sorts of foods (I don't think I can have bison in my neighborhood!) I do plan to plant some of the beans that are recommended for my area, and I'll try some of the other veggies that are recommended for the midwest (I'm on the cusp of the plains and the mountains.)
